Eurasian integration development processes were discussed in the Northern capital of Russia

The III International Conference Eurasian Challenge took place in St. Petersburg. It was co-organized by the Committee for External Relations of St. Petersburg and the North-West Institute of Management of the Russian Federation Presidential Academy of National Economy and Public Administration.

The main topics of the conference were “The role of the EEU in a global world of the 21st century”, “The EEU facing new geo-economic and geo-political challenges”, “The role of business in the development of EEU integration". Cooperation in the field of innovation”, and “The EEU and regional international organizations: challenges and cooperation prospects (EEU and SCO, ASEAN, EEU and EU)”.

Deputy Chief of Unit, Model Law-Making in Social and Humanitarian Sphere Aleksandr Surygin co-moderated the round table “The EEU and regional international organizations: challenges and prospects of cooperation”. The Executive Secretary of YIPA CIS Margarita Safarova was a co-moderator of the panel discussion “The youth startups as a driver of innovations in the EEU”.
